Red Flags
When examining audemarsgroup.com, several warning signs emerge that are typical of fraudulent investment platforms.
| Red Flag | Description |
|---|---|
| Unrealistic profit claims | Promises of high returns with little or no risk |
| High-pressure tactics | Persistent calls or messages encouraging immediate deposits |
| Withdrawal obstacles | Unexpected fees or conditions when requesting funds |
One of the most concerning issues with audemarsgroup.com is its withdrawal process. Users may see growing balances in their accounts, giving the illusion that their investments are performing well. However, when they try to withdraw funds, the platform often imposes new conditions. Requests for additional payments labeled as “taxes,” “verification fees,” or “account activation charges” are commonly reported. These tactics are intended to extract more money from investors rather than allow them access to their own funds.

Recovery Solutions
If you believe you were affected by audemarsgroup.com, taking action quickly is essential. While recovery of lost funds is not guaranteed, the following steps may help:
-
Contact your bank or payment provider immediately to report the transactions and inquire about possible chargebacks or reversals.
-
Gather and preserve all evidence, including emails, chats, transaction records, and screenshots of account activity.
-
Report the incident to financial fraud or consumer protection authorities to create an official record.
-
Cease all communication with the platform and any associated agents to prevent additional pressure or financial loss.
-
